'Spy City': TV Review

"You don't seem like a man who would like a boring life," a character tells Dominic Cooper's Fielding Scott, a spy navigating the uncertain streets of divided Berlin circa 1961, in AMC+'s Spy City. It's unclear how she's making this judgment, since other than looking like a man who enjoys a well-tailored suit, Fielding Scott doesn't lend himself to much of a read at all — even after the six-episode entirety of Spy City.

Louis Armstrong Doc In the Works at Apple, Imagine Documentaries

Apple Original Films has ordered Black & Blues: The Colorful Ballad of Louis Armstrong, a documentary about the life and pioneering career of the jazz legend Louis Armstrong from Brian Grazer and Ron Howard’s Imagine Documentaries. The biopic, to be directed by Sacha Jenkins, will tell Armstrong’s story through the musical great's own words.

Mia Isaac Joins John Cho In ‘Don’t Make Me Go’ From Director Hannah Marks & Amazon Studios

EXCLUSIVE: Newcomer Mia Isaac has landed the lead role opposite John Cho in Don’t Make Me Go, the father-daughter adventure dramedy from Amazon Studios. Hannah Marks is directing the film, which follows a single father who takes his teenage daughter on a road trip to find her estranged mother, as he tries to teach her everything she might need to know for the rest of her life along the way.

Director Alma Har’el Inks First-Look TV Deal With Amazon Studios

EXCLUSIVE: Amazon Studios has closed a first-look television deal with award-winning director Alma Har’el (Honey Boy) and her newly formed production company, Zusa. Under the pact, Har’el will work with the studio to develop and create new television series to run exclusively on Amazon Prime Video.

Apple And Imagine Documentaries Team On Louis Armstrong Doc ‘Black & Blues: The Colorful Ballad Of Louis Armstrong’

Apple Original Films has green lit its Louis Armstrong documentary feature, Black & Blues: The Colorful Ballad of Louis Armstrong with Imagine Documentaries producing the documentary. The documentary, which is produced under Apple’s first-look agreement with Imagine Documentaries, will be directed by Emmy-nominated Sacha Jenkins , and produced by Jenkins, Julie Anderson, Sara Bernstein and Justin Wilkes.

‘Spy City’: Dominic Cooper’s Pitch Perfect Performance Elevates AMC+’s Engrossing Espionage Tale [Review]

Smart and stylish, AMC+’s “Spy City” captures a tumultuous time and place in world history: Berlin just before the forming of the Wall in 1961. The title of the show comes to life in the way writer William Boyd (“Chaplin”) and director Miguel Alexandre present an interlocking story of espionage that brings in multiple operatives from governments around the world.

Amazon Studios Hires Nick Pepper to Oversee IP and Talent Management

Elaine Low Senior TV WriterNick Pepper is joining Amazon Studios as head of studio creative content, where he will be tasked with packaging and maximizing the studio’s intellectual property and talent deals.The hiring follows a restructuring of Amazon Studio’s executive leadership team last month, which included Marc Resteghini’s elevation to head of development and the addition of Laura Lancaster as head of series.
